Overview

The Donovan's Venom, INC. is a non-profit 501(c)(3) tax-exempt organization dedicated to taking music, art, and entertainment to those who need it most. We provide resources to individuals who lack access to fine arts and performance opportunities, with a focus on universal accessibility to music education and fine art. We are committed to ensuring that everyone, regardless of financial circumstances, has access to high-quality music education, performance opportunities, and fine art.
